## Formula sandbox tuning

User-supplied formulas in Gridmoor execute inside a restricted interpreter with hard ceilings on time, memory, and call depth. Reviewers should confirm any change to these ceilings is justified in the PR description, since raising them widens the abuse surface. Defaults were chosen from production traces. The current limits are as follows.

limits module of tafog-fawip:
WEIGHTS = {
    "julix": 57,
    "lamys": 992,
    "kasvan": 209,
    "quenok": 750,
    "alddor": 259,
    "oliath": 1009,
    "wenix": 815,
}

// -----------------------------------------------------------------
// Broker upgrade note for the security reviewer:
// We bumped the Quibble message broker to the 4.x line, mostly to
// pick up the patched auth handshake. The constant below pins the
// minimum accepted protocol version — older Hollowpine clients will
// be rejected on connect, which is intentional. Please double-check
// the pin before sign-off. The upgrade build's trace token follows.
// -----------------------------------------------------------------

session token of tadug-bagep = htk9_7d92de289

## Nightbatch Scheduler — Environments

Nightbatch runs the nightly backfills for the Tallgrass analytics pipeline. We keep three environments: dev (runs hourly so you can actually test things), staging (mirrors prod cron timing), and prod. Each environment pins its own window and concurrency caps, so don't copy-paste between them. Before you approve changes here, sanity-check against the current prod values, which are as follows.

deployment values, fahap-hahaf:
[casdor]
port = 9200
region = south-2
host = casdor.qirvanworks.corp
timeout_ms = 3000
retries = 4

Handover: Starwick catalog cache. Invalidation is event-driven via the Pylon bus; price changes purge by SKU, category edits purge whole shards. Known gap: bulk imports skip events, so run the manual sweep after any import before release sign-off. Sweep procedure and cache metrics are documented on the internal page here.

wiki page, tahaf-tajog: https://jira.ordindyn.corp/pipeline